Our Sales Supervisor, Mari, recently visited Mexico on our inaugural Mexico departure. She discovered a place where ancient indigenous cultures meet modern inventions and form the most fascinating hybrids!

My journey through Mexico took me to amazing places. One which deserves a special mention is San Juan de Chamula, a small town just outside San Cristobal de las Casas. Here Maya culture is alive and well, and visiting the local church really blew my mind.
